Publisher's summary

The modern apologetics classic that started it all is now completely revised and updated - because the truth of the Bible doesn't change, but its critics do. With the original Evidence That Demands a Verdict, best-selling author Josh McDowell gave Christian audiences the answers they needed to defend their faith against the harshest critics and skeptics.

Since that time, Evidence has remained a trusted resource for believers young and old. Bringing historical documentation and the best modern scholarship to bear on the trustworthiness of the Bible and its teachings, this extensive volume has encouraged and strengthened millions.

Now, with his son Sean McDowell, Josh McDowell has updated and expanded this classic resource for a new generation. This is a book that invites listeners to bring their doubts and doesn't shy away from the tough questions.

  • Thoroughly revised and updated from the previous edition
  • Now coauthored by Josh McDowell and Sean McDowell
  • All-new chapters defending against the latest attacks from Christianity's critics
  • Designed to be a go-to reference for even the toughest questions
  • Offers thoughtful responses to the Bible's most difficult and extraordinary passages
  • Expansive defense of Christianity's core truths, including the resurrection of Jesus Christ

AN UPDATED CLASSIC...AMAZING IN BREADTH AND DEPTH

This is now my #1 recommendation for anyone wanting to go deeper into their understanding of apologetics. Josh McDowell has been impacting the world through apologetics for nearly 60 years. And his son Sean is a popular seasoned apologist in his own right.

Josh's first edition of this classic was published nearly 50 years ago (1972). As a high school student, I devoured it in the late 70s. Aside from immersing myself in God's Word, it was probably the most instrumental thing that I did to strengthen my faith in order to weather the many storms of life that would come. As a father and son team, they have produced the most solid edition of this book yet. The book is amazing in its breadth and its depth, and yet it is written in such a way as to be accessible by a more popular audience (older high school and up). The narrator is also excellent, and makes this 43 hour audio book pleasing to listen to.

Comprehensive, a bit too literal, but solid

This is probably the most comprehensive and exhaustive look into the historicity of the entire Bible. It is so much more than Case for Christ and Cold Case Christianity, and a different beast than Mere Christianity or Simply Jesus. This is not the breezy repartee of Rob Bell or Pete Enns and does not ha e the classical beauty of CS Lewis. But it is a good book. I read it on Kindle a couple of years ago and had similar pros and cons. I’m a liberal progressive Christian and found some of the stuff in here just wrong or at least poorly construed. 50% of it is told straight without much bent, but another portion is too conservative and a decent amount is just far too literal. I’m a Christian but I’m also a math and science teacher (and a history major). I do not need literal proof of the OT. The entire gist rests on the resurrection and I accept that, burnt out does not mean you have to accept literal cosmic origin stories, impossible ages of human, or much of the OT “history.”
The narration is passable, hence the 3 stars. The book lends itself to reading more than listening but it’s still an ok listen.
